Wear Resistant Ceramic Rubber Composite Liner is engineered by combining high-performance alumina ceramics (cylinders, hexagons, or plates) vulcanized within a resilient rubber base. These panels can be supplied with or without steel backing depending on application requirements.

Our wear liners are essential for systems handling abrasive materials:
| Feeding Systems | Belt head hoppers, trolley tee buckets, feed hoppers |
| Sintering Systems | Vibrating screens, beneficiation hoppers, silos |
| Dust Removal | Dust pipes, elbows, tees, tail dust pipes |
| Coking & Milling | Coke hoppers, coal injection pipes, burner cones |
